Apa itu Stop Kontak?
Stop kontak, or electrical outlets as they’re known in English, are the points where we plug in our devices to access electrical power. They are the gateway between the electrical wiring in our walls and the appliances we use every day. Without stop kontak, our homes would be pretty useless in this modern age, right? Fungsi Utama Stop Kontak
The main function of a stop kontak is simple: to provide a safe and convenient point of connection to the electrical supply. But there's more to it than just sticking a plug in a hole! A well-designed stop kontak ensures that the electrical connection is secure and that the risk of electrical shock is minimized. They are designed with safety features like grounding pins, which help protect us from dangerous electrical faults. Jenis-Jenis Stop Kontak
There are various types of stop kontak available, each designed to meet specific needs and safety standards. The most common types include:
- Standard Outlets: These are the basic outlets you find in most homes, typically with two or three holes.
- GFCI Outlets (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ter): These are special outlets designed to protect against electrical shock, especially in wet areas like bathrooms and kitchens. They have a “test” and “reset” button on the front.
- USB Outlets: These outlets have built-in USB ports, allowing you to charge your devices directly without needing a separate adapter.
- Smart Outlets: These are connected to your home network and can be controlled remotely, allowing you to turn devices on and off from your smartphone.
Each type has its own set of advantages, and choosing the right one depends on your specific needs and the location where it will be installed. For example, you wouldn't want to install a standard outlet in your bathroom – a GFCI outlet is a much safer choice!

Apa itu Terminal Listrik?
Now, let's move on to terminal listrik. These are the connection points where electrical wires are joined together. Think of them as the central hubs that distribute electricity throughout your home. They are typically found in electrical panels, junction boxes, and within electrical appliances themselves. Understanding terminal listrik is crucial for ensuring the safe and efficient operation of your electrical system.
Fungsi Utama Terminal Listrik
The primary function of terminal listrik is to provide a secure and reliable connection between electrical wires. This connection must be able to carry the required current without overheating or causing a fire hazard. Terminal listrik also play a crucial role in maintaining the integrity of the electrical circuit, ensuring that electricity flows smoothly and efficiently.
Jenis-Jenis Terminal Listrik
There are many different types of terminal listrik, each designed for specific applications. Some of the most common types include:
- Screw Terminals: These are the most common type of terminal listrik, where wires are secured by tightening a screw.
- Push-In Terminals: These terminals allow you to simply push the wire into the terminal, making for a quick and easy connection.
- Wire Connectors (Wire Nuts): These are plastic caps that twist onto the ends of wires to create a secure connection.
- Terminal Blocks: These are modular blocks that can be used to create a series of connected terminals.
Each type has its own advantages and disadvantages. Screw terminals are reliable but can be time-consuming to install. Push-in terminals are quick and easy but may not be as secure as screw terminals. Wire connectors are great for making connections in junction boxes, while terminal blocks are ideal for creating organized wiring systems.
Memilih Terminal Listrik yang Tepat
Choosing the right terminal listrik involves considering several factors. First, think about the size and type of wires you will be connecting. The terminal listrik must be able to accommodate the wire gauge and be compatible with the wire material (copper or aluminum). Next, consider the current rating of the terminal listrik. It must be able to handle the maximum current that will flow through the circuit. Finally, think about the environment where the terminal listrik will be used. Will it be exposed to moisture or extreme temperatures? By considering these factors, you can choose a terminal listrik that ensures a safe and reliable electrical connection.
Panduan Instalasi Stop Kontak yang Aman
Installing a stop kontak might seem like a simple task, but it's crucial to follow safety guidelines to prevent electrical shock and other hazards. Here's a step-by-step guide to safe stop kontak installation:
- Turn Off the Power: Always, always, always turn off the power to the circuit at the breaker box before working on any electrical wiring. This is the most important safety precaution.
- Remove the Old Outlet: Carefully remove the old stop kontak from the wall box. Inspect the wires for any signs of damage.
- Connect the Wires: Connect the wires to the new stop kontak, matching the colors. Black wires go to the brass screw, white wires go to the silver screw, and the ground wire (usually green or bare) goes to the green screw.
- Secure the Outlet: Carefully push the stop kontak back into the wall box and secure it with screws.
- Test the Outlet: Turn the power back on at the breaker box and test the stop kontak with a circuit tester to make sure it's working properly.
Important Safety Tips:
- Never work on electrical wiring when the power is on.
- Always use insulated tools.
- If you're not comfortable working with electricity, hire a qualified electrician.
Tips Merawat Stop Kontak dan Terminal Listrik
Maintaining your stop kontak and terminal listrik is essential for ensuring their safe and reliable operation. Here are some tips to keep them in top condition:
- Regular Inspections: Periodically inspect your stop kontak and terminal listrik for any signs of damage, such as cracks, discoloration, or loose wires.
- Tighten Loose Connections: If you find any loose connections, tighten them carefully. Loose connections can cause overheating and create a fire hazard.
- Replace Damaged Components: Replace any damaged stop kontak or terminal listrik immediately. Don't wait until it becomes a safety issue.
- Keep Them Clean: Keep your stop kontak and terminal listrik clean and free of dust and debris. Dust can accumulate and cause overheating.
- Avoid Overloading: Don't overload your stop kontak with too many appliances. This can cause the circuit breaker to trip or, in extreme cases, start a fire.
Troubleshooting Umum pada Stop Kontak
Even with proper installation and maintenance, stop kontak can sometimes experience problems. Here are some common issues and how to troubleshoot them:
- Outlet Not Working: If an outlet isn't working, check the circuit breaker first. If the breaker has tripped, reset it. If the outlet still doesn't work, there may be a loose wire or other problem that requires professional attention.
- Outlet Feels Hot: If an outlet feels hot to the touch, this could indicate a serious problem. Turn off the power to the circuit immediately and call an electrician.
- Sparks or Smoke: If you see sparks or smoke coming from an outlet, turn off the power to the circuit immediately and call an electrician. This is a sign of a serious electrical problem.
- GFCI Outlet Tripping: If a GFCI outlet is constantly tripping, there may be a ground fault in the circuit. Try resetting the outlet. If it continues to trip, call an electrician.
